Homelessness Surges in NJ: A Look at the Alarming 24% Increase

the staff of the Ridgewood blog

The crisis of homelessness in America is escalating, and New Jersey is feeling the painful impact. According to the January 2024 Point-in-Time count, 12,680 people were experiencing homelessness on a single night in the state—a staggering 24% increase from the previous year.
